📄 About

turnkey self-hosted offline transcription and diarization service with llm summary

transcriptionstream has 944 stars on GitHub. It has been forked 54 times. transcriptionstream is written mainly in Python. It has been in active development since 2023. transcriptionstream is available under the GPL-3.0 license. Its main topics are automation, diarization, llm, mistral-7b.
